I think there is some stronghold in my life that drives me to redeem myself, especially vocationally. The thinking goes something like this: I know it would please God, if I can only achieve such and such. I don’t think my desire to be effective or significant is sinful, but when it becomes the driving force of my life it is flowing out of shame, and a demand that God help me with my will rather than the other way around. Repentance looks like remembering all the ways my own demands have led to sin and sorrow; like turning from that “self-made” strategy to whatever God’s will for my life is. There is so much rest in that about face.
